Types of Beach Buggy Kits

Beach buggies come in various shapes and sizes, each designed for specific uses and preferences. Understanding the different types of beach buggy kits can help you make an informed decision based on your lifestyle.

Dune Buggies

Dune buggies are lightweight vehicles often designed for sandy terrains. These buggies are typically open, allowing for a thrilling experience while driving on the beach. Companies like www.buggybuilders.org offer a range of chassis and body options to customize your dune buggy experience.

Fiberglass Buggies

Fiberglass kits are popular for their durability and customizability. They allow enthusiasts to build their unique buggies. East Coast Buggies provides a variety of fiberglass body kits, ensuring you can create a vehicle that meets your style and functionality requirements.

Turnkey Buggies

For those who prefer convenience, turnkey buggies come fully assembled minus the engine and transmission. Companies like Oreion Motors specialize in these models, allowing customers to choose their powertrain easily. This option is ideal for those who want a beach-ready vehicle without the hassle of assembly.

Electric Beach Wagons

Electric beach wagons, such as those offered by sandhopper.com, are designed to transport beach gear effortlessly. These wagons are perfect for families or groups who want to enjoy a day at the beach without the burden of carrying heavy items.

Classic Buggies

Classic buggies evoke nostalgia with their retro designs. They are often favored for leisurely drives and car shows. Customization options are available from various manufacturers, allowing you to own a piece of automotive history.

Key Features to Consider

When choosing a beach buggy kit, several features can influence your decision. Understanding these features can help you select the best option for your needs.

Build Quality

The build quality of a beach buggy is crucial for performance and longevity. Look for kits that use high-grade materials like fiberglass or durable metal. For example, ffbuggies.co.uk emphasizes ease of construction and the use of quality materials.

Customization Options

Many enthusiasts enjoy customizing their buggies. Consider the variety of customization options available, from body styles to colors. Acme Car Company offers a wide range of colors and styles for fiberglass buggies, making it easy to personalize your vehicle.

Engine Compatibility

Understanding engine compatibility is vital, especially if you’re going for a turnkey kit. Some companies provide a list of compatible engines, making it easier to choose the right powertrain for your needs. Meyers Manx provides guidance on compatible engines and performance upgrades.

Price and Value

Pricing can vary significantly among different buggy kits. Assess what features are included in the price and determine if it aligns with your budget. For example, dune buggies can range from $3,000 to $10,000, while turnkey options can go up to $25,000.

User Support and Community

Choose a manufacturer that offers excellent customer support and has an active community. This can be beneficial for troubleshooting and advice. Websites like beachbuggy.info are great resources for enthusiasts to connect and share their experiences.

FAQ

What is a beach buggy?
A beach buggy is a lightweight vehicle designed for driving on sandy terrains, often featuring an open design and customizable options for enthusiasts.

What are the benefits of fiberglass buggies?
Fiberglass buggies are durable, customizable, and can be tailored to fit personal preferences, making them popular among DIY builders.

How long does it take to assemble a dune buggy kit?
Assembly time can vary but generally takes between 20 to 40 hours, depending on the complexity of the kit and the builder’s experience.

Are turnkey buggies worth the investment?
Turnkey buggies offer convenience and are ready to drive with minimal setup, making them a good investment for those seeking ease of use.

Can I customize my beach buggy?
Yes, many manufacturers offer extensive customization options, from body styles to paint colors, allowing you to create a unique vehicle.

What engine should I choose for my beach buggy?
The best engine depends on your buggy type and intended use. VW-based engines are common, but many kits allow for custom engine options.

Is it easy to find parts for beach buggies?
Yes, many companies specialize in parts for beach buggies, and there are active communities that share resources and tips.

What is the average cost of a beach buggy kit?
Prices can range from $1,500 for electric beach wagons to over $25,000 for fully equipped turnkey buggies, depending on features and customization.

Are beach buggies safe for children?
Safety depends on the design and features of the buggy. Always ensure that appropriate safety measures, such as seat belts and helmets, are in place.
